Because of China: The announcement of the new UN envoy to Yemen delayed

New York, The announcement of the new UN envoy to Yemen was delayed, the Swedish ambassador, Hans Grundberg, who had announced by UN Secretary-General Antonio Guterres, last July as a fourth UN envoy to Yemen since 2011.
The envoy was ratified by the Yemeni government and four of the five permanent members of the Security Council, while China has abstained from voting so far, which is the reason for the delay in the announcement. According to source in New York.
The source said that he asked two ambassadors close to the Yemeni file in the UN Security Council, and both of them have no enough information about the reason for the delay of the Chinese approval.
Until now, we do not know the reasons, and it has become a mystery about which diplomats and journalists alike whisper. What we do know is (that) the Chinese ambassador is now on summer vacation,” adding, “There is no time frame for giving approval but others have.”the source said.
